Control philosophy
Titan Battlefronts rewards intentional inputs. The developers printed three tips on the Roblox page for a reason: aiming is manual, many abilities are hold-based, and shift lock is a stance — not a set-and-forget setting.
PC baseline
| Action | Typical input |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Move | WASD | Strafe while keeping camera ready |
| Aim | Mouse | Cursor/camera direction drives shots |
| Jump | Space | Use for beam dodges, not spam |
| Shift lock | Shift (or Roblox toggle) | On for melee, off for many guns |
| Abilities | Number keys / assigned binds | Hold when the skill channels |
Rebind only after you understand defaults. Fancy keyboards do not fix early releases.
Mobile baseline
| Action | Input |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Move | Left thumb stick | Keep thumb loose for micro-adjusts |
| Aim | Right-side camera drag | This is your mouse equivalent |
| Skills | On-screen buttons | Hold the button; do not flick tap |
| Shift lock | Toggle icon if present | Same melee/ranged rule |
Landscape orientation almost always aims better than portrait. See also mobile guide.
Shift lock decision tree
- About to melee combo? Shift lock ON.
- About to shoot a skillshot? Shift lock OFF.
- Enemy closed the gap mid-cast? Toggle as you transition.
- Confused? Pause in a quiet corner and reset.

Hold-to-channel lab (five minutes)
Pick any continuous ability. Time how long you naturally hold it. Then force yourself to hold until the effect truly ends. Many beginners cut beams at 40% strength and wonder why damage feels weak.
Accessibility and comfort
Lower camera sensitivity if you overflick. Increase it if you cannot track strafing morphs. On laptops, consider a cheap mouse before blaming the game. Colorblind players should maximize contrast in Roblox settings so Alliance morph silhouettes stay readable.
Controls during PVE
Objectives force camera turns while moving. Practice aiming while walking sideways around a static prop before entering PVE & crafts. Held skills that lock movement need earlier activation so you are already planted on the point.
Controls versus Game Pass morphs
Pass morphs like Injured Hero or Glitch Soldier still obey the same input rules. Fancy VFX does not remove hold requirements. Read game passes after your hands are trained.
Troubleshooting input issues
- Skills stop immediately: you are tapping instead of holding.
- Shots go wide: shift lock is fighting your aim — turn it off.
- Mobile buttons miss: scale UI in Roblox settings.
- Keyboard ghosting: avoid pressing too many keys on cheap membranes.

Controller notes
Some players route Roblox through controllers. If you do, map a dedicated button for shift-lock toggle and another that is comfortable to hold for long channels. Controllers that soft-release triggers will sabotage beam morphs. Test hold stability for ten seconds before queueing ranked-feeling lobbies.

Should shift lock always be on?
No. Use it for melee fights and usually turn it off for shooting abilities.
Why do my abilities stop early?
Many skills require you to hold the button. Releasing cancels them.
How do I aim on mobile?
Move the camera with your right thumb — that is your aim method per the official tips.
